Purchased 12/2001 with 68,000 miles, now has 114,000 and going great, but having trouble finding parts for convertible only. Lost the paint color chip when I replaced spare tire cover, trunk leaked and ruined it. Top leaks but only in heavy rain, heard it was a common problem. I need a top, and a few minor trim items repaired that probably I only notice, but it still looks great and gets comments on how good it looks.

I have grown to hate this car over the years. The cheap plastic components, cheap finish, basic design flaws and tedious repairs have made owing this car a pain. Why can't GM make cars that do fall apart after a few years. I have had to change the transmission pan gasket about four times, the altenator twice, the starter three times and other numerous nonsense repairs. Even the dashboard display lights have gone out on me and it is a pain to replace the lights.

Bought the car with 100K on it. It currently has 175,000 miles and STILL going strong. Never had to take it to the dealer for an oil leak. The timing belt is on a steel chain so it never has to be replaced. Minor problems: had to replace A/C compressor at 145K, solonoids for transmission at 130K, broken antenna motor at 135K. The car is strongly built, not filmsy like Japanese cars. A BIG pleasure to drive! Very COMFY!

I loved this car for the first two years I had it. Then it developed an intermittent stalling problem. It will just quit. Sometimes when you are stopped, but sometimes when you are driving. We have been five months trying to fix it. Has been in two different garages for a total of 8 times. No codes show up on the computer. We have tried everything we know, but are ready to give up. The car only has 80K miles, but we will have to trade it in for practically nothing. It is so frustrating. No more GMs for me.

The controls knobs for radio, AC,& fan have snapped off many times; power windows & antennae quit; alterantor has been replaced; trim around door handles has to be tighted constantly because Olds was too cheap to put more than one screw in it. The plastic trim in the trunk panel has been replaced, the paint is flaking off the "alloy" wheels. The dash board rattles due to use of 2 different materials in it- on hot or cold days the materials have different rates of expansion & so always rattle. The hinges on the trunk door take up so much space when closed that you can't fit two large suitcases in there.
